Class 7 Chapter 2 Nutrition In Animals Que Ans Ratna Sa The various process involved in obtaining nutrition in animals are as follows: 1) ingestion the process of taking food inside our mouth is known as ingestion. 2) digestion the process of breaking down food into molecules is known as digestion. 3) absorption the process of absorbing the digested food through the villi of small intestine is.
